Roman Reigns returns on WWE Raw
The Tribal Chief is back in WWE.
Roman Reigns made his return to the promotion in the main event segment of Monday’s WWE Raw, his first appearance on WWE programming since the Raw after WrestleMania 41 in April.
Reigns cleared the ring of Bron Breakker and Bronson Reed in the aftermath of the gauntlet match to determine Gunther’s SummerSlam opponent, making the save for Jey Uso and CM Punk.
Punk and Breakker were the final two competitors in the gauntlet, with Reed interfering on Breakker’s behalf. Uso was a participant in the match and eliminated earlier in the bout, but came back to the ring to neutralize Reed’s interference, allowing Punk to score the victory.
In his return, Reigns made it clear that he was aligned with Uso and not yet with Punk, helping Uso to his feet, but ignoring Punk’s handshake offer.
A Reigns and Uso vs. Breakker and Reed tag team match for SummerSlam appears to be the direction for the returning Reigns in his first match since WrestleMania 41, although that has yet to be officially announced.
